阿里云CDN全称为Content Delivery Network,即内容分发网络,其核心作用是通过全球部署的边缘节点将静态资源缓存至离用户最近的位置,从而显著降低延迟、提升加载速度并减轻源站压力。
阿里云CDN的技术原理与核心价值
分发网络并非单一服务器,而是一个分布式的系统架构,当用户访问网站时,请求会被智能调度到距离物理位置或网络跳数最近的边缘节点,这个节点如果缓存了所需资源,便直接返回数据;如果没有,则回源站获取并缓存,这种机制彻底改变了传统“单点直连”的模式。
业内专家指出,这种分布式架构是解决互联网高并发访问瓶颈的关键,对于电商大促、视频直播或游戏更新等场景,流量往往在瞬间爆发,源站服务器难以承受如此巨大的冲击,CDN通过分散流量,确保了服务的稳定性。
为什么选择CDN能提升用户体验
用户体验的核心指标是加载速度,研究表明,页面加载时间每增加1秒,转化率可能下降7%,阿里云CDN通过以下技术手段优化这一指标:
- 智能路由调度:实时监测全网节点状态,自动选择最优路径,避开拥堵链路。
- 协议优化:支持HTTP/2、QUIC等新一代协议,减少握手次数,加快连接建立。
- 边缘计算能力:在节点端进行简单的逻辑处理,如鉴权、裁剪,减少回源请求。
源站防护与安全加固
除了加速,安全也是CDN的重要职能,阿里云CDN内置了Web应用防火墙(WAF)和DDoS防护能力。
抵御恶意攻击
当遭遇大规模CC攻击或SQL注入尝试时,CDN节点可以在边缘直接拦截恶意请求,防止其到达源站,这对于金融、政务等高安全要求行业至关重要。
HTTPS加密传输

全站HTTPS已成为标配,阿里云CDN提供免费的SSL证书托管和自动续期服务,确保数据传输过程中的机密性和完整性,提升用户信任度。
阿里云CDN与其他服务商的对比分析
在选型阶段,许多企业会在阿里云CDN和腾讯云CDN对比中犹豫不决,虽然两者在基础加速能力上差异不大,但在生态整合和特定场景优化上各有侧重。
生态整合度的差异
如果你的业务主要运行在阿里云的其他产品上,如OSS(对象存储)、ECS(云服务器)或MaxCompute,使用阿里云CDN可以获得更无缝的体验。
- 配置简化:无需额外配置跨账号权限,域名解析和源站绑定在控制台内一键完成。
- 数据互通:日志分析可以直接对接阿里云日志服务SLS,便于统一监控和排查问题。
- 计费统一:所有资源在同一账单体系下,便于成本管理和优化。
相比之下,腾讯云CDN在社交生态(如微信小程序、公众号)的接入上具有天然优势,若你的业务重度依赖微信生态,腾讯云可能提供更低延迟的接入体验。
价格策略与性价比
价格是决策的重要因素。阿里云CDN价格表显示,其采用按流量计费或按带宽峰值计费两种模式,对于流量波动大的业务,按流量计费更经济;对于带宽稳定、峰值明显的业务,按带宽计费更可控。
| 计费模式 | 适用场景 | 优势 | 劣势 |
|---|---|---|---|
| 按流量计费 | 流量波动大,有闲时 | 用多少付多少,无闲置成本 | 突发流量可能导致费用激增 |
| 按带宽峰值 | 带宽稳定,峰值明显 | 成本可预测,便于预算控制 | 闲时带宽浪费,成本固定 |
行业共识认为,没有绝对的最优价格,只有最匹配业务模型的价格策略,建议通过阿里云控制台的价格计算器,输入预估流量和带宽,进行模拟测算。
实操指南:如何快速部署阿里云CDN
对于技术团队而言,快速上线并验证效果是首要任务,以下是标准的部署路径。
第一步:域名接入与配置
- 登录阿里云CDN控制台。
- 添加域名,填写加速域名和源站地址(支持IP或域名)。
- 选择加速区域,通常选择“中国大陆”或“全球”。
- 配置缓存规则,设置不同类型文件(如图片、JS、CSS)的缓存过期时间。
第二步:解析切换
将域名的CNAME记录指向阿里云提供的CNAME地址,这一步至关重要,错误的解析会导致加速失效。
- 检查点:使用nslookup或dig命令验证解析是否生效。
- 生效时间:DNS解析通常需几分钟到几小时,建议先在测试环境验证。
第三步:预热与刷新
新上线或更新资源后,边缘节点可能没有缓存,此时需要进行操作:
- 刷新预热:主动将热门资源推送到边缘节点,缩短首次访问延迟。
- 适用场景:新品发布、活动页面上线前。
常见问题与解决方案
阿里云CDN缓存不更新怎么办
这是最常见的运维问题,原因通常是缓存过期时间设置过长,或浏览器缓存未清除。

- 解决方案1:在控制台执行“刷新预热”,强制清除节点缓存。
- 解决方案2:修改文件名或添加版本号参数(如?v=1.1),绕过浏览器缓存。
- 解决方案3:检查源站响应头中的Cache-Control和Expires字段,确保配置正确。
阿里云CDN和OSS搭配使用最佳实践
静态资源托管在OSS上,通过CDN加速,是经典的架构组合。
- 优势:OSS提供高可靠存储,CDN提供高速分发,两者结合实现存储与计算分离。
- 配置要点:在OSS Bucket中开启静态页面托管,并将CDN源站指向OSS域名。
- 注意事项:确保OSS Bucket的读写权限设置为“公共读”或配置CDN回源鉴权,防止资源被盗链。
阿里云CDN流量异常飙升如何处理
流量突然激增可能源于正常活动,也可能遭受攻击。
- 排查步骤:登录控制台查看流量监控图表,分析高峰时段和来源IP。
- 应对措施:若为正常活动,可临时提升带宽峰值上限;若为攻击,启用WAF防护,并限制单IP访问频率。
- 成本控制:设置流量预警阈值,当流量超过设定值时,通过短信或邮件通知管理员。
阿里云CDN作为全球领先的内容分发网络服务,不仅提供了强大的加速能力,还集成了安全、监控、数据分析等全方位功能,对于追求高性能、高可用和低成本的企业而言,它是一个经过市场验证的可靠选择,通过合理配置缓存策略、选择合适的计费模式以及结合OSS等云产品,可以最大化发挥其价值,在实际应用中,建议定期回顾流量数据和成本账单,持续优化架构,以适应业务的增长变化。
首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/377086.html

